## Tuning the formula sandbox

User-supplied formulas in Calqora run inside a restricted evaluator with hard ceilings on recursion depth, evaluation time, and allocated cells. These ceilings exist to protect shared workers, so raise them only with a reviewed justification. New team members should test any change against the adversarial formula suite before merging. The current sandbox ceilings are listed below.

tuning table, yajog-yahof:
BUDGETS = {
    "lamvan": 303,
    "wenox": 460,
    "fenvan": 525,
}

The Inkwell rendering pipeline converts user-submitted markdown in three stages: parse, sanitize, render. Sanitization happens after parsing so raw HTML nodes are stripped against an allowlist before templating; please scrutinize that allowlist first, as it is the main injection surface. Renderer workers run in a sandboxed pool with no network egress. To open the sealed review environment containing sample payloads and the sanitizer config, enter the recovery passphrase provided below.

strongbox words: norwyn-wenael-aldvan-aldiel-wendor-holael

Quick recap for the weekly sync: the GridSheet spreadsheet exporter still balloons memory on workbooks over ~200k rows, and when the worker gets OOM-killed mid-export, the service account sometimes ends up locked by the Northvale auth daemon's flap detection. If that happens, don't bump the memory limit and retry — unlock the account first or you'll just burn another attempt. Run the recovery flow from the exporter's admin shell; it re-registers the worker and then prompts for the recovery passphrase, noted right below.

vault phrase of bagaf-kajeg = jorath-feniel-briir-siliel-ralix

## Session Handling — Contrast Audit Notes

Welcome aboard. The Lanternleaf accessibility audit flagged several low-contrast states in our session UI: the expired-session banner, the idle-timeout modal, and the re-auth prompt on Duskwell themes. Each session state is rendered by the Pinewright component library, so fixes go there, not in app code. Screenshots of failing states live in the audit folder. To run the contrast-checker service against staging sessions, authenticate with the token below.

session JWT of yawep-yawep = eyJhbGciOiJIUzI1NiIsInR5cCI6IkpXVCJ9.eyJzdWIiOiI3pWF3_In0.aXYsHiog